Title: The Innovative Mind of Andrew Swann
Introduction
Andrew Swann is a notable inventor based in London, GB, recognized for his contributions to technology through his innovative patents. With a total of eight patents to his name, Swann has made significant strides in the field of video playback and virtual environments. His work reflects a deep understanding of both technical and creative aspects of invention.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Swann has developed an "Apparatus and method of video playback." This method involves obtaining a 3D reconstruction of an environment and aligning video footage with the corresponding views of that environment. Another significant patent is the "Apparatus and method of generating a representation of a virtual environment." This method includes creating a mesh of the virtual environment and populating a texture map with representations of its patches, ensuring that the visual output is both accurate and aesthetically pleasing.
